Pre-market plan helps reveal something brutal.

You write out your bias. Price should go up. Longs are the play.

Then at the end of the day, you review your trades.

And you find out you were shorting all day long.

This happens more than you think.

Your higher timeframe analysis says one thing. Your trades say another.

The plan is the framework. But did you actually trade within it?

Most traders don't even notice the contradiction.

They had a directional bias. Then completely ignored it.

Here's how you use pre-market planning correctly...

Set your plan. Then at end of session, compare it to what price actually did.

How close were you? How accurate was your analysis?

But more importantly - did you TRADE your analysis?

Because if you thought price would go up and you shorted all day?

That's an easy area for improvement right there.

You're literally working against yourself...
